Output 56ac974b96ef30a20dba1603d4ca9b98f0d713697a15248cac02a583f94d0781:0

value
21008036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95df001c63daf57cc7a782454291e02167af5673 OP_EQUAL
address
3FMTkU7LoN1CqHzBQDDyYhVtHXSTMqdjpP
transaction
56ac974b96ef30a20dba1603d4ca9b98f0d713697a15248cac02a583f94d0781
confirmations
297198
spent
true